A kind of leveling structure
Technical field
The utility model belongs to technical field of buildings, specifically, is to be related to a kind of to be used for levelling structure on the ground.
Background technology
In daily decorative engineering, it usually needs first levelling to building ground progress, floor is then re-layed, to ensure paving If after floor it is smooth.
Current leveling operations, mainly pours into ground by cement mortar, and cement mortar is according to the longitudinal irregularity on ground Potential barrier is moved, and Automatic Levelling is carried out to ground, is taken longer.
The content of the invention
The utility model provides a kind of leveling structure, the problem of solving floor leveling in the prior art time-consuming.

Embodiment
In order that the purpose of this utility model, technical scheme and advantage are more clearly understood, below with reference to accompanying drawing and reality Example is applied, the utility model is described in further detail.
The leveling structure of the present embodiment, mainly includes leveling part and many square tubes 1 etc., shown in Figure 1;Leveling part is main Including base and bolt, the bottom surface of base offers screw, and bolt is threadedly coupled with screw, is formed with base and square tube grafting Plug connector;The horizontal genesis analysis of many square tubes, is formed latticed(The grid can be described as levelling net), many square tubes pass through leveling The plug connector of part is connected with each other.
The leveling structure of the present embodiment, is connected many square tubes by the plug connector of leveling part, and the base bottom of leveling part Portion and bolt connection, the head of bolt are supported on the ground, and the screw rod of bolt is connected with whorl of base, left-handed or right-hand bolt head Portion, screw rod is rotated, and can be moved upwardly or downwardly base, is driven connected square tube to be moved upwardly or downwardly, therefore, is passed through The bolt of multiple leveling parts is adjusted, all square tubes in whole grid can be caused to be in same level height, so as to realize ground Quick levelling, the reduction floor leveling required time in face;And leveling structure is simple to operate, stability is high, be easy to implement, cost It is low.
The leveling part of the present embodiment includes cross leveling part 2;Cross leveling part 2 includes base 2-1 and bolt 2-3, Base 2-1 bottom surface offers screw 2-1-1, and bolt 2-3 is threadedly coupled with screw 2-1-1, is formed with base 2-1 and square tube The plug connector 2-2 of 1 grafting, plug connector 2-2 are the cuboid being adapted to square tube, and plug connector 2-2 is inserted into square tube;In cross In leveling part 2, base 2-1 surrounding is formed with four plug connector 2-2, and four plug connector 2-2 are uniformly laid, in cross Shape, referring to shown in Fig. 2 to Fig. 5.Because cross leveling part 2 has four plug connector 2-2, it can be connected with four square tubes around, Therefore be mainly used in being fixedly connected for square tube inside grid, can be certainly also used at grid edge and corner's square tube company Connect, occupation mode is flexible and changeable., can be conveniently fast by setting cross leveling part so that plug connector and square tube convenient disassembly The connection of square tube is realized fastly, further reduces the floor leveling time.
In order to save material, leveling part also includes T-shaped leveling part 3, is mainly used in the connection of grid edge prescription pipe.T-shaped Leveling part 3 includes base 3-1 and bolt, and base 3-1 bottom surface offers screw 3-1-1, and bolt connects with screw 3-1-1 screw threads Connect, the plug connector 3-2 with the grafting of square tube 1 is formed with base 3-1, plug connector 3-2 is the cuboid being adapted to square tube, plug connector 3-2 is inserted into square tube;In T-shaped leveling part 3, base 3-1 surrounding is formed with three plug connector 3-2, three grafting Part 3-2 is T-shaped to be laid, shown in Figure 6.Because T-shaped leveling part 3 has three plug connector 3-2, it can connect with three square tubes around Connect, therefore be mainly used in being fixedly connected for grid edge prescription pipe, can be certainly also used to the connection of grid corner prescription pipe, use Mode is flexible and changeable.By setting T-shaped leveling part, material is both saved, plug connector and square tube convenient disassembly are caused again, can be facilitated The connection of square tube is rapidly realized, further reduces the floor leveling time.
In order to further save material, leveling part also includes L-shaped leveling part 4, the connection for grid corner prescription pipe.L Shape leveling part 4 includes base 4-1, and base 4-1 bottom surface offers screw 4-1-1, and bolt is threadedly coupled with screw 4-1-1, bottom The plug connector 4-2 with the grafting of square tube 1 is formed with seat 4-1, plug connector 4-2 is the cuboid being adapted to square tube, and plug connector 4-2 is inserted Enter into square tube;In L-shaped leveling part 4, base 4-1 surrounding is formed with two plug connectors 4-2, described two plug connector 4-2 It is L-shaped to lay, it is shown in Figure 7.Because L-shaped leveling part 4 has two plug connector 4-2, it can be connected with two square tubes of surrounding, because This is mainly used in being fixedly connected for grid corner prescription pipe.By setting L-shaped leveling part, material is both saved, plug connector is caused again With square tube convenient disassembly, the connection of square tube can be quickly and easily realized, further reduces the floor leveling time.
Because room floors are mostly square, therefore levelling grid is generally square, and in square net, cross is levelling Part, T-shaped leveling part, L-shaped leveling part can meet the demand of square tube connection.It is of course also possible to according to the actual feelings of grid Condition, designs the levelling part of other shapes, however it is not limited to the example above.
In the present embodiment, base is the cuboid with square top surface and bottom surface, in order to which floor leveling is operated.When So, for the ease of processing, multiple plug connector shapes and sizes of same leveling part are identical and in the same plane.
Below by taking cross leveling part as an example, the concrete structure for exchanging horizontal member is described in detail.
The distance of plug connector 2-2 and base 2-1 top surfaces is equal to the wall thickness of square tube 1, shown in Figure 6, therefore, works as plug connector When 2-2 is inserted into square tube 1, the top surface of square tube 1 and base 2-1 either flush easily facilitate leveling operations, further improved Levelling reliability and accuracy.
The distance of plug connector 2-2 and base 2-1 bottom surfaces is equal to the wall thickness of square tube 1, shown in Figure 6, therefore, works as plug connector When 2-2 is inserted into square tube 1, the bottom surface of square tube 1 is concordant with base 2-1 bottom surface, with further improve levelling reliability and Accuracy.
For the ease of processing, and it is easy to adjust the height of each square tube, the length of each square tube is 250mm~350mm. In the length range, both avoided square tube length is long from being difficult to adjust its height, regulating part caused by avoiding square tube length too short again Using excessive, therefore in the length range, the height of square tube was both conveniently adjusted, appropriate number of regulating part can be used again, Reduce cost.As a kind of preferred design of the present embodiment, the length of each square tube is 300mm.
The wall thickness of each square tube is 1.5mm~2.5mm, had both avoided wall thickness is excessive from causing waste of material, wall thickness mistake is avoided again It is small to cause hardness to reduce.In the thickness range, the quality of square tube can be ensured, again can be by material cost control in rational model In enclosing.As a kind of preferred design of the present embodiment, the wall thickness of each square tube is 2mm.
In the present embodiment, the length of bolt is 20mm~50mm, the length of screw and the length adaptation of bolt, namely bottom The height adjustment range of seat is that the height adjustment range of 20mm~50mm, i.e. square tube is 20mm~50mm;Due to the height on ground Drop is typically not more than 50mm, therefore in the length range, can both meet the demand of floor leveling, avoid bolt long again Spend and cause to waste greatly.As a kind of preferred design of the present embodiment, the length of bolt is 35mm.
In the present embodiment, base, bolt, square tube are aluminium alloy, light weight and anti-corrosion, and service life is long, it is ensured that building Quality.
Specific construction process is as follows:
(1)According to the actual size of room floors, the distance between base has been divided, the square tube of suitable length has been cut, such as 250mm~350mm.
(2)Many square tubes are connected with each other by leveling part, formed latticed.
The connection of square tube uses cross leveling part inside levelling grid;The connection of grid edge prescription pipe is adjusted using T-shaped Horizontal member, the connection of grid corner prescription pipe uses L-shaped leveling part.
(3)According to the levelling control line ejected in advance on metope, the bolt of leveling part is adjusted so that the institute in whole grid There is square tube to be in same level height, i.e., it is concordant with levelling control line.
(4)Grid is filled and led up using cement mortar.
So far, floor leveling construction complete, subsequently can on the ground after levelling laying floor etc..
